Upgrade & Currency Changed To Dollars From Pounds


Question

Posted

We have updated blesta to 3.4.2 & since then random clients invoices have changed to AUS Dollars. We have never used Dollars, only pounds. Not sure why this has happen.

 

Does anyone know which database table has the client currency stored so i can check they are all set to pounds? Is there anyway to remove the other currencies as we have never used them and never will.

Settings > Company > Currencies > Active Currencies to remove any not in use.

 

We have had a few people complain about charges not going through. They were using USD but had clients with invoices in AUD. I'm not sure this is related, but I wonder if there may be a bug in here someplace that is causing the currency to revert to or default to AUD.
